Partial hospitalization/Day Treatment is a kind of out-patient drug and alcohol rehab program that is just below intensive outpatient and more intensive than regular outpatient rehab. Partial Hospitalization Day Treatment is also designed to help people who may need intensive treatment for a co-occurring mental health disorder, but do not need around the clock supervision and care. For a client who has completed inpatient rehabilitation, a partial hospitalization day treatment plan in Sumas could help them transition more easily into a drug or alcohol free way of life as a "step-down" option. After partial hospitalization day treatment, the client could then transition into regular outpatient care.
When a person is in a partial hospitalization day treatment facility, they commonly take part in services anywhere from 3-5 days per week. It is similar to an inpatient treatment program in many significant ways, including the fact that people will get access tonurses, physicians, and mental health professionals who can address the psychological, emotional, and physical issues they are trying to conquer. For at least 4-6 hours on the days that individuals attend partial hospitalization day treatment, the clients will receive personalized addiction therapy, psychotherapy services, participate in group counseling, receive any necessary medical care and deal with any of the mental health problems that are triggering their drug addiction.
